Qatar National Teams Performance
Since Felix Sanchez’s arrival in Qatar in 2006, the country has made significant development. He started a football program in Qatar after ten years of employment in Barcelona. He oversaw the U-19 selection from 2013 to 2017, and after that, the national team. Under his direction, Qatar is performing admirably, and he was a major factor in their Asian Cup victory three years ago.
Qatar does not have a single player from outside of the country in its squad. Every player competes in a domestic league and is anonymous to the broader public. Almoez Ali, a striker who was born in Sudan, is the finest player. In the offensive phase, Captain Hassan Al-Haydos is also crucial, while left-back Abdelkarim Hassan poses a serious threat.

Ecuador National Teams Performance
On the other side, in 2002, Ecuador made its World Cup debut. They played twice more after that. Their finest performance came in 2006 when England knocked them out in the Round of 16. Ecuador performed admirably throughout CONMEBOL qualifying. Despite coming in fourth, they spent the most time there.
Enner Valencia of Fenerbahce is a standout forward for his country. Michael Estrada, who led the qualifying with numerous significant goals, is also deserving of notice. Robert Arboleda and Piero Hincapie oversee defense, with Carlos Gruezo and Sebas Mendez standing out in midfield. Pervis Estupinan, a left back, is also crucial.

QAT vs ECU possible starting lineup:
Félix Sánchez, the manager of Qatar, is Spanish and has them playing more offensively. They used a 3-5-2 formation for the majority of their prosperous Gold Cup run before switching to a 5-3-2 shape when playing defense. They demonstrated a strong rate of goal-scoring during the tournament as a result, but they also had defensive weaknesses. Under manager Gustavo Alfaro, Ecuador plays a versatile style, switching between 4-3-3, 4-2-3-1, and 4-4-1-1 formations. They prefer to play directly, advancing with the ball rather than attempting to hold onto it. Ecuador tied Argentina for the second-most goals scored in CONMEBOL during the qualification period with a total of twenty-seven.
